Job Description

YOUR TASKS AND RESPONSIBILITIES

 

The primary responsibilities of this role, Site Lead, are to: 

 

  • Proactively seek and communicate broader business objectives and key messages to their site;
  • Provide and receive feedback for development of self and others (direct reports, peers, partner, people leader, etc.);
  • Ensure that critical conversations, coaching and development planning are happening at the site;
  • Champion cross-functional (Commercial, Product Supply, other Breeding) functions, etc., including regional and global inclusion and collaboration;
  • Recognize individual and team accomplishments;
  • Motivate and empower the team to take pride and ownership in their processes;
  • Drive continuous improvement and regularly share key findings and opportunities with other sites;
  • Facilitate a culture of change;
  • Deliver business objectives defined for the site;
  • Prioritize resources such as budget, labor, supplies, etc. to meet HSE (Health / Safety / Environment), Regulatory, and Corporate policy requirements for the site, to ensure Freedom to Operate (FTO);
  • Create a culture of safety, quality, and compliance;
  • Develop, track and keep team apprised of site and organizational Metrics;
  • Regulate and Stewardship responsibility for trial types under the hub’s responsibility;
  • Serve as a role model for others to follow, when complying with our Company's LIFE (Leadership, Integrity, Flexibility, Efficiency) principles and policies;
  • Manage and engage in the daily activities of the site’s operations;
  • Ensure that all site members are trained on standard work processes and tools and establish key contacts for accountability and follow-up;
  • Acquire and maintain facilities and equipment for effective and efficient functioning of all programs;
  • Drive the vision and goals for the site, to align with Bayer’s strategy;
  • Own and maintain contingency plans for the site;
  • Forecast and own all aspects of budgeting and capital alignment with the site’s long-term plan;
  • Identify and build a talent pipeline strategy for the site;
  • Ensure the site delivers on all community engagement objectives;
  • Actively involved with "Telling Our Story" (social media, community events, media, etc.), as well as acting as an ambassador for Bayer;
  • Actively build industry relations and participate in local agriculture groups;
  • Organize Community Advisory Panel (as applicable);
  • Maintain Government Relations and represent Bayer as knowledge/ industry expert in public forums (as applicable).

 


WHO YOU ARE
 
Your success will be driven by your demonstration of our LIFE values.  More specifically related to this position, Bayer seeks an incumbent who possesses the following:
 
Required Qualifications:

 

  • Ph.D. with at least four years’ relevant experience, or Master’s of Science with at least eight years’ relevant experience, or Bachelor’s of Science with at least ten years’ relevant experience;
  • Four years’ demonstrated people leadership experience with seasonal workers or full-time employees, or managing a team of employees through project management;
  • Strong decision-making, prioritization, and problem-solving skills;
  • Strong computer skills related to data acquisition, organization and analysis;
  • Demonstrated flexibility in an agile work environment;
  • Excellent communication and influencing skills;
  • Broad knowledge of crop production and farming practices;
  • Good working knowledge of research operations and ability to interpret/ interact with large sets of data;
  • Proven ability to help multiple stakeholders and advocate for/ understand modern agriculture;
  • Valid Driver’s License. Driving record (MVR) will be reviewed and must meet guidelines based on the company’s Risk Screening for Hiring Drivers;
  • Ability to lift up to 60lbs.
